Myself and my husband JP are the owners of Active Body Physical Therapy. My role with the clinic is primarily on the business side. I worked at Hotel Dieu Grace Hospital for 5 years and am currently doing home care physiotherapy for Community Care Therapy. In my career I have worked with a variety of populations and conditions including: pediatrics, geriatrics, neurology, neurosurgery, cardiorespiratory, orthopaedics, and post-surgery. I have taken several post-graduate courses including McKenzie, Acupuncture, courses with A.P.T.E.I., Level 2 Manual Therapy, Karen Orlando's Balls, Bands and Balance and University level business courses. My primary area of interest is working with clients with osteoporosis. I enjoy the challenge of having to work on core stability, balance, strength and conditioning and falls prevention. I completed my MelioGuide to Stronger Bones, working with osteoporosis and osteopenia Level I Training Certification and hope to become more involved with osteoporsis projects in the future.
